Features of beta version of KeepSolid E-sign

  • It is still in beta version and it will be released by the end of 2017
  • It works both offline and online
  • It is available on Mac, iOS, Android and Windows
  • It has already got several beta users
  • It allows users to sign with a finger
  • It is in beta and hence functionality is limited
  • It is the best solution for companies and businesses as there is no need of legal services
  • It’s paperless
  • It’s normal and final version will be released in 2018
  • It is free at present but will require subscription in future
  • It is a part of the portfolio of KeepSolid products
